| Features | Benefits |
|---|---|
| Four belt construction | Increases casing and tread stiffness, minimizing tire deformation for longer wear |
| Advanced Equal Force Casing technology | Uniform force distribution enables optimal tire footprint at various loads level thus result in regular tread wear |
| Widened tread layout | Large tread volume for extended wear life |
| Giti specially-formulated tread compound | Improved wear resistance of tread |
| Resilient four vertical groove and zig-zag bottom design | Provides better handling and controllability of vehicle |
| Mutiple sipes along the side of groove | Self cleaning capability and higher resistance to damage from road hazards |
| Tire casing designed for retreadability | Higher retreadable capabilities |
| FEA bead construction optimization concept for bead construction | Optimizes and uniformly distributes load pressure to the bead, minimizing damage |
